`( 3125^x xx 5^9)/ 625 = (125)^-1`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

`(3125^x xx5^9)/625 = 125^-1`
`=>(3125^x xx5^9)/5^4 = 1/5^3`
`=>(3125^x xx5^8) = 1`
`=>((5^5)^x xx 5^8) = 5^0`
`=>5^(5x+8) = 5^0`
`5x+8 = 0=> x = -8/5`
